89 formula dash light problem

i have no gauge illumination...a few days ago i was driving at night and when i hit the high beams the dash went dark....the 5 amp fuse was blown so i changed it...it worked for about 30 seconds then blew the fuse again so i put a 10 amp fuse instead of a 5 and it worked for about 30 secs again then went dark but didn't blow the fuse...please help me

Re: 89 formula dash light problem

NEVER put in a higher amp fuse in a circuit that keeps blowing fuses...You probably burned a wire since you said the fuse didn't blow.
One of the common places for a short is atthe EGR solenoid connector..this is wired to the gauge fuse circuit.
